Jan Kraus Sues Trading Platformโ for Unauthorized Use of Likeness
Prague, Czech Republic – Actorโข andโฃ comedian Jan Kraus has initiated legal proceedings against Ohniskotradevo.com, a trading platform, for falselyโ claiming his endorsement. Teh company utilized Kraus’s image and name in promotional materials without his consent, leading him to file a lawsuit seeking damages andโฃ a cessation of the deceptive marketing practices.
The case highlights a growing concern regarding the misuse of publicโข figures’ โคidentities to lend false credibility to potentially fraudulent financial schemes. Ohniskotradevo.com aggressively markets itself to Czech citizens with promises of easy profitsโข and โa user-friendly platform, while simultaneously creating a sense of exclusivity and urgency.โ The unauthorized use of Kraus’s โlikeness is a keyโ indicator ofโข the platform’s questionable โtactics, raising alarms among consumer protection advocates and legal experts.
According to a report published โby Parlamentnรญ listy,โฃ Ohniskotradevo.com prominentlyโฃ featured fabricated endorsements from Kraus on its website and in promotional materials. The platform boasts an “intuitive” interface, accessibility from any device, and “complete data protection,” but lacks verifiable evidence to support these claims. It alsoโฃ limits registration toโค Czech citizens โand artificially restricts the number of available places, employing tactics designed to pressure potential investors.
Kraus’s legal โteam argues that the platform’s actions constitute a clear violation of โhis personal rights and a purposeful attempt to mislead the public. The lawsuit seeks not only financial compensation for the unauthorized use โof his image โฃbut โขalso a court order preventingโ Ohniskotradevo.com from continuing to exploit his reputation.
The case is ongoing,and authorities have been alerted to the platform’s potentially deceptive practices. โConsumers are advised to exercise extreme caution and thoroughly research any investment opportunities before committing funds, particularly those promoted with unsubstantiated claims and celebrity endorsements.
